Description |
The P34 protein is the main allergen for soybean sensitive
humans. Soybean protein P34, a thiol protease belonging to
the papain family, is a monomeric allergen having an
N-terminal amino acid sequence and amino acid composition
identical to that of the seed 34kDa protein. It is an
insoluble glycoprotein having a pI of 4.5 and a calculated
mass of 28.643 Dalton, representing 2–3% of total soybean
protein. Upon glycosylation, the mass will be somewhat
larger, resulting in a 32kDa band in non-reduced SDS PAGE
gels. It exhibits no enzymatic function due to an absence of
the catalytic cysteine. P34 is stored in storage vacuoles of
soybean cotyledons. |
